About the Project

The Town of Caledon has initiated a Schedule ‘C’ Municipal Class Environmental Assessment (Class EA) to review alternative solutions for improvements to Chinguacousy Road from Mayfield Road to Old School Road.  

Through the 2051 panning horizon, Caledon is forecasted to grow from a population of approximately 80,000 residents to approximately 300,000. The Caledon Transportation Master Plan (TMP) has identified the corridor of Chinguacousy Road from Mayfield Road to Old School Road as an area needing road improvements to service the current growth in the area and the future planned Peel Region’s urban boundary expansion.  

The project is in the environmental assessment and preliminary design phase. Our consultant for this phase is Ainley Group. Following this phase, the detailed design will be undertaken and finalized for construction.

 Purpose of the Study
 

The purpose of the study is to consider the improvement needs that will provide opportunity to increase corridor capacity corresponding with the forecasted growth and traffic demands as identified in the Town’s Transportation Master Plan. Creating multimodal transportation options will support active transportation and the creation of complete communities. The study will consider:

  • Road widening for additional lanes
  • Geometric and intersection improvements
  • Active transportation and transit facilities
  • Access management

 Project Timeline
 
  • April 2021 – Notice of Study Commencement
  • Summer 2022 – Public Information Centre 1

Present Phase 1 and 2 of the Environmental Assessment including the problem/opportunity statement, existing  conditions, technical study finding and alternative solutions. 

  • Fall 2022 – Public Information Centre 2

     Present alternative design concepts and review input
